CaptainMediocre47

I assume you mean Haven. It seems like an okay map, but this has a core flaw where the US team has a quicker run to C, D and arguably B. This means the US team can potentially have 3 flags already capped if a chunk goes ahead and makes a tough front for the RU team between C and E. I have played at least 6 matches in the Haven 24/7 and Infantry Conquest playlists, and every single time the US team has absolutely wiped the floor with the RU team (minimum win margins were around 300 tickets). Rinse and repeat, same pattern. Every time I'm on the RU team, C flag and B flag are half to 3/4th capped by the time I can even breakthrough to them once I get past the frontline established by the US team. Same issue existed in Operation Metro btw. One team had a quicker run to B, and the other team had to go "uphill" and on average the team going uphill (I think it was the US team), lost. Other than that, it's just tons of buildings, which means campers, snipers, mindless destruction galore. Lane wise it seems okay, better than some of their other 2042 maps, but still not it for me. I also feel the game in general just hosts too many players per server. I think if the player count reduced to 48 it might be a better map. 64 players in a map this tight is way too chaotic, 128 would be insanity. It already feels like a meat grinder. Maybe this is why they've been rumoured to dial down the player count per server for the next game and focus on revamping the way they make maps.
